Welcome to the Garrow Deck team. The occupancy feed aggregates stall counts from sensors across the Millhaven garages and publishes them to the Lotwise API every two minutes. As on-call, your main duty is restarting the aggregator when counts freeze. Any redeploy of the aggregator must be signed, or the Lotwise edge nodes will reject it. The current deploy key follows.

rollout seal: bky4_DFM9

Subject: Inkwell markdown pipeline 5.1 deployed

On-call: the Inkwell rendering pipeline is now on 5.1 in production. Changes: sanitizer runs before the table parser, footnote rendering is cached per document, and the fallback plain-text path no longer strips headings. If render latency alarms fire, roll back via the standard script — it handles cache invalidation. Known issue: nested blockquotes over six levels render flat. The deployment trace token follows.

build token for hawep-kageg: htk14_558814e2114cc7

Ticket: VRX-2214 — Signature check failing on autocomplete index bundle

The nightly build of the Tindercrest autocomplete index fails verification on the Molloway edge nodes. Index build itself is slow (42 min, up from 9) but completes; the bundle then fails the signature gate. We suspect the rotation last week left stale trust material on the edges. For your review, the currently active signing key is below.

deploy key for kajof-yawif: bky9_fvxrpdHPq